Transaction 10c76aa10876d514181a7617714dc18e302f364532de0ce138152df4519376a3
1 Input
1 Output
-
10c76aa10876d514181a7617714dc18e302f364532de0ce138152df4519376a3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 915bc85efa3d5064e0394231f958185ad171900288be4b183cc535fa062657bf
- address
- bc1pj9dushh684gxfcpeggcljkqcttghryqz3zlykxpuc56l5p3x27lsen65cc